## Approvals: Role-Based Access

Quick heads-up for reviewers: the Fernwick wiki uses three roles — Reader, Contributor, and Steward. Only Stewards can approve page moves or permission changes, and every approval is logged in the Ledgerleaf audit feed. Contributors can draft but not publish to the Policies space. Role grants themselves need a second Steward's thumbs-up. All access escalations route through one final approver.

named custodian: Ulador Kasath Zoreth

## Deploying the Gatewick Proctor Queue

Deploys are pretty painless: push to main, wait for the pipeline, then watch the queue drain dashboard for five minutes. If candidates pile up mid-exam, roll back first and ask questions later — the queue replays safely. Everything the workers care about lives in one config block, shown here for reference.

settings of bafof-yagef:
JOROX_PIN=8740
JOROX_TENANT=pelox
JOROX_METRICS_HOST=metrics.jorox.qorvelworks.internal
JOROX_SEAL=seal_c78f63c1
JOROX_STANDBY_TEAM=norax

# Break-Glass: Catalog Cache Invalidation

Scope: the Pinrow product catalog at Veldstone Retail. If stale prices persist after a purge and the Hollowmere invalidation queue is wedged, use break-glass to flush the edge tier directly. Contractors: get verbal sign-off from the catalog lead first. Steps: open the Hollowmere admin shell, select emergency-flush, confirm the tenant, and run it once — repeated flushes thrash the origin. Access is logged and expires after 20 minutes. Unseal the admin shell with the passphrase below.

recovery phrase for kahop-tajog: istix-casvan

Handover — Fonts vendoring (Tallow UI)

For the sync: I finished vendoring the third-party fonts into the Tallow asset bundle, so we no longer fetch them at build time. Licenses are recorded in the manifest, and the CDN fallback is removed. Priya takes over verification next week. The bundler currently runs with these configuration values:

service settings:
[casax]
port = 6379
team = rusir
host = casax.zemvarhq.corp
region = outer-4
access_code = ac_9808ce
timeout_ms = 1500